CClash.CompilerCacheBase.CopyOutputFiles C# (CSharp) Method

CopyOutputFiles() public method

public CopyOutputFiles ( ICompiler comp, DataHash hc ) : void
comp ICompiler
hc DataHash
return void
        void CopyOutputFiles( ICompiler comp, DataHash hc)
        {
            try
            {
                CopyFile(outputCache.MakePath(hc.Hash, F_Object), comp.ObjectTarget);
                if (comp.GeneratePdb && comp.AttemptPdb && comp.PdbFile != null)
                    CopyFile(outputCache.MakePath(hc.Hash, F_Pdb), comp.PdbFile);
            }
            catch (Exception e)
            {
                Logging.Error("{0}",e);
                throw;
            }
        }